The Yankees did a few roster-spot saving moves in order to prepare themselves for free agency and the Rule V Draft.
First of all, as of now, every Yankees that was eligible to be a free agent is no longer on the 40 man roster - this means Kerry Wood, Andy Pettitte, Mariano Rivera, Javier Vazquez, Lance Berkman, Nick Johnson, Austin Kearns, Derek Jeter, Chad Moeller, and Marcus Thames.
Furthermore, they outrighted two players off of the roster - Royce Ring and Chad Gaudin, allowing them both to become free agents.
Finally, they added one player to the 40 man roster in order to protect from being a minor league free agent. They added 23-year-old outfielder Melky Mesa to the roster. Mesa hit .260/.338/.475 with 19 homeruns and 49 total extra base hits in 446 at-bats last year with Single-A Tampa. He would have been a six-year minor league free agent had he not been added to the roster.
